smoke curtains are typically made of fire-resistant materials such as fiberglass or silicone-coated fabric. They are installed in buildings to partition large open spaces, such as atriums, lobbies, and stairwells, creating compartments that help control the flow of smoke in the event of a fire. When activated, smoke curtains deploy from their compact housing units and descend vertically to create a barrier that prevents smoke from spreading to other areas of the building.
One of the key benefits of smoke curtains is their ability to compartmentalize a building, containing smoke and fire to localized areas. This not only protects occupants by providing clear escape routes but also minimizes property damage by limiting the spread of fire. By confining smoke to a specific zone, smoke curtains help maintain visibility and air quality, allowing occupants to evacuate safely and emergency responders to navigate the building more efficiently.
